The colour of the beer is reddish brown, perhaps chestnut. The liquid is clear. The foam is white, finely bubbled, high and persistent. It coats the glass very nicely.
Aroma is grassy, earthy and cellar-like, there are fruity notes (raspberry) and in the background there are 'country' accents, slightly wild and wet wood.
The taste is minimally sour and definitely more bitter. The bitterness feels 'dry' and has the character of wet wood and or fruit stones.
Saturation medium. Body medium. Round texture. Long bitter, stone fruit aftertaste.
